WebApr 7, 2024 · Sometimes, your gums can bleed when you make changes in your oral hygiene habits. A common example of this is when you forget to floss for a while, then start flossing again. Another example would be when breaking in a new toothbrush that may be slightly stiffer than your old toothbrush. WebDec 18, 2024 · The main cause of bleeding gums while flossing is due to inflammation in the gum tissue caused by bacteria. This inflammation is known as gingivitis and it's the most common form of periodontal disease (or gum disease).
